Output 5530df3c866e32f032074b8e17da46c70b086b07ff18abdd76629fd13ddb98ff:1

value
68583565
script pubkey
OP_0 OP_PUSHBYTES_20 e5ebb1ca33e8facd2d7d92363f79af41cc6db326
address
bc1quh4mrj3narav6ttajgmr77d0g8xxmvexec3jwa
transaction
5530df3c866e32f032074b8e17da46c70b086b07ff18abdd76629fd13ddb98ff
confirmations
341051
spent
true